Around a hundred conscripts from the northern region have departed for their conscription service – to the 103rd Vitebsk Separate Guards Airborne Brigade, BELTA correspondent reports.

The future paratroopers were among the first to be sent for their conscription service in the current autumn draft. Their departure point was Victory Square – a landmark not only for the residents of Vitebsk but for the entire region.
